Home
last modified time | relevance | path

Searched refs:enetc_ndev_priv (Results 1 – 6 of 6) sorted by relevance

/Linux-v6.1/drivers/net/ethernet/freescale/enetc/
Denetc.h330 struct enetc_ndev_priv { struct
383 int enetc_alloc_msix(struct enetc_ndev_priv *priv); argument
384 void enetc_free_msix(struct enetc_ndev_priv *priv);
386 void enetc_init_si_rings_params(struct enetc_ndev_priv *priv);
387 int enetc_alloc_si_resources(struct enetc_ndev_priv *priv);
388 void enetc_free_si_resources(struct enetc_ndev_priv *priv);
389 int enetc_configure_si(struct enetc_ndev_priv *priv);
463 void enetc_sched_speed_set(struct enetc_ndev_priv *priv, int speed);
469 int enetc_psfp_init(struct enetc_ndev_priv *priv);
470 int enetc_psfp_clean(struct enetc_ndev_priv *priv);
[all …]
Denetc_ethtool.c36 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_reglen()
55 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_regs()
212 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_sset_count()
232 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_strings()
272 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_ethtool_stats()
307 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_pause_stats()
386 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_eth_mac_stats()
395 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_eth_ctrl_stats()
405 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_rmon_stats()
524 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_rxnfc()
[all …]
Denetc_qos.c17 void enetc_sched_speed_set(struct enetc_ndev_priv *priv, int speed) in enetc_sched_speed_set()
49 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_setup_taprio()
138 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_setup_tc_taprio()
179 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_setup_tc_cbs()
295 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_setup_tc_txtime()
454 static int enetc_streamid_hw_set(struct enetc_ndev_priv *priv, in enetc_streamid_hw_set()
546 static int enetc_streamfilter_hw_set(struct enetc_ndev_priv *priv, in enetc_streamfilter_hw_set()
603 static int enetc_streamcounter_hw_get(struct enetc_ndev_priv *priv, in enetc_streamcounter_hw_get()
682 static int enetc_streamgate_hw_set(struct enetc_ndev_priv *priv, in enetc_streamgate_hw_set()
803 static int enetc_flowmeter_hw_set(struct enetc_ndev_priv *priv, in enetc_flowmeter_hw_set()
[all …]
Denetc.c14 static int enetc_num_stack_tx_queues(struct enetc_ndev_priv *priv) in enetc_num_stack_tx_queues()
26 static struct enetc_bdr *enetc_rx_ring_from_xdp_tx_ring(struct enetc_ndev_priv *priv, in enetc_rx_ring_from_xdp_tx_ring()
129 struct enetc_ndev_priv *priv = netdev_priv(tx_ring->ndev); in enetc_map_tx_buffs()
572 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_start_xmit()
632 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_xmit()
758 struct enetc_ndev_priv *priv = netdev_priv(tx_ring->ndev); in enetc_recycle_xdp_tx_buff()
798 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_clean_tx_ring()
966 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_get_rx_tstamp()
989 struct enetc_ndev_priv *priv = netdev_priv(rx_ring->ndev); in enetc_get_offloads()
1348 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_xdp_xmit()
[all …]
Denetc_vf.c48 static int enetc_msg_vsi_set_primary_mac_addr(struct enetc_ndev_priv *priv, in enetc_msg_vsi_set_primary_mac_addr()
79 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_vf_set_mac_addr()
122 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_vf_netdev_setup()
157 struct enetc_ndev_priv *priv; in enetc_vf_probe()
233 struct enetc_ndev_priv *priv; in enetc_vf_remove()
Denetc_pf.c38 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_mac_addr()
199 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_rx_mode()
295 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_vlan_rx_add_vid()
310 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_vlan_rx_del_vid()
321 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_set_loopback()
345 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_vf_mac()
364 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_vf_vlan()
383 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_vf_spoofchk()
730 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_set_features()
799 struct enetc_ndev_priv *priv = netdev_priv(ndev); in enetc_pf_netdev_setup()
[all …]